Lernert Engelberts and Sander Plug wanted to learn a new instrument, so naturally they did what anyone else would do… they built an 18th century-style duo glass harp and learned to play it in 8 weeks. What song did they learn? No Limit by 2 Unlimited, of course!

The award for best free font of 2008 goes to, Quicksand. Designed by Andrew Paglinawan, Quicksand comes in a variety of styles and weights. Download it here.
